Two nights ago Beatrice's Mom came over to watch some television. When I opened the door, however, and said "Hi," she responded with, "Kitten." Uh, kitten? Sure enough, there by the food dish was a kitten I'd never seen before. A bit of chasing later and hey, there's an angry, angry kitten in my bathroom. (And a lot of blood from a kitten bite on my thumb, and a trip to the doctor for a tetanus shot in my very near future.)

He seems to be about 3months old or so and very, very dirty. He spent most of yesterday growling and huddling in the bathtub. But by last night he let me pet him a little (while hissing.) This morning he let me pet him, and leaned into the pets. Then, breakthrough! This afternoon he stretched up into the pets and started purring! I was able to pick him up (and discover that he is, in fact, a he) and plop him my lap-- where he promptly started rolling about and asking for me to pet his belly!!
We still have a ways to go-- I can't get him to play, for example. And he starts to growl whenever he sees me, but stops when I start petting him. He's eating well, and using the litter box with no trouble. He let me clean out his very dirty, very gross ears, although I suspect there'll be more of that to come, too. He clearly has worms (ew!) because he has the roundest belly ever.
